Question to the Foreign, Commonwealth & Development Office:

To ask the Secretary of State for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Affairs, how much his Department has committed to spend on (a) the Commonwealth Development Corporation, (b) the Global Fund, (c) European Union international development spending, (d) the GAVI Alliance, (e) Official Development Assistance (ODA)-eligible in-country refugee costs, (f) ODA-eligible climate changed related work, in 2021-22.

This question was answered on 22nd February 2021

The Foreign Secretary has set out seven core priorities for the UK's aid budget in the overarching pursuit of poverty reduction: climate and biodiversity; COVID-19 and global health security; girls' education; science and research; defending open societies and resolving conflict; humanitarian assistance; and promoting trade and economic growth. We are working through our internal business planning process which will allocate the ODA budget across these priorities and geographies.

No decisions have yet been made on budget allocations for 2021/22.
